在当今数字化浪潮席卷全球的背景下,苹果软件开发正逐步成为连接技术、商业与用户体验的核心枢纽。随着iPhone、iPad、Mac以及Apple Watch等设备生态的持续扩张,用户对高质量应用的需求日益增长,这不仅推动了开发者群体的活跃度,也催生了全新的商业模式和创新机会。尤其是在移动应用市场趋于饱和的今天,能否掌握苹果软件开发的核心能力,直接决定了一个产品是否能在激烈的竞争中脱颖而出。从底层架构到上层交互,苹果构建了一套高度集成且安全可控的技术体系,为开发者提供了前所未有的创作空间。
提升用户体验:苹果软件开发的底层逻辑
苹果软件开发之所以能赢得广泛认可,首要原因在于其对用户体验的极致追求。无论是iOS系统的流畅性,还是App Store中精心筛选的应用质量,都体现了“以用户为中心”的设计理念。通过Swift语言的现代化语法结构与高性能编译机制,开发者能够更高效地编写出响应迅速、内存占用低的应用程序。同时,UIKit和SwiftUI框架的不断演进,使得界面设计更具一致性与可维护性。这种技术上的优势,让基于苹果平台的应用在启动速度、动画表现和触控反馈等方面显著优于同类竞品。对于希望打造高端品牌形象的企业而言,掌握苹果软件开发意味着能够将产品体验做到行业标杆级别。
增强应用安全性:构建可信数字环境的关键
在数据泄露频发的时代,安全性已成为用户选择应用时的重要考量因素。苹果软件开发天然具备强大的安全基因,其沙盒机制、代码签名验证、权限分级管理等特性,从源头上降低了恶意行为的风险。此外,App Store严格的审核流程虽然有时被诟病为“繁琐”,但正是这一机制有效过滤了大量低质或存在安全隐患的应用。开发者若能在设计阶段就融入安全思维,如合理使用Keychain存储敏感信息、启用ATS(App Transport Security)加密通信,不仅能提高应用通过审核的概率,还能增强用户的信任感。尤其在金融、医疗、教育等领域,高安全标准往往是准入门槛,而苹果软件开发则为满足这些严苛要求提供了可靠保障。

构建高溢价产品力:从功能实现到品牌价值跃迁
当基础功能趋于同质化,差异化竞争便转向了产品的整体质感与情感连接。苹果软件开发支持深度集成Core ML、ARKit、HealthKit等系统级服务,使应用具备人工智能推理、增强现实交互、健康数据分析等前沿能力。例如,一款健身类应用可通过Core ML实现实时动作识别,结合Apple Watch的心率监测数据,提供个性化训练建议;又如零售品牌利用ARKit实现虚拟试衣,极大提升了线上购物的沉浸感。这类创新不仅提升了功能性,更赋予产品独特的情感价值与社交传播力,从而形成高溢价能力。对企业而言,这意味着可以通过苹果软件开发打造出具有长期竞争力的品牌资产。
主流实践现状:跨设备协同与AI深度融合
当前,苹果软件开发已不再局限于单一设备的适配,而是迈向多终端无缝协作的新阶段。借助Continuity、Handoff、Universal Clipboard等特性,用户可以在iPhone、iPad、Mac之间自由切换工作流,这对开发者提出了更高的架构要求。采用Combine框架进行异步编程,配合SceneDelegate与EnvironmentObject实现状态共享,已成为构建跨设备应用的标准做法。与此同时,人工智能正在深度渗透到每一个应用场景中。从Siri语音助手的自然语言理解,到照片分类中的图像识别,再到实时翻译功能的本地化处理,背后都是苹果软件开发中对机器学习模型的轻量化部署与高效调用。这些趋势表明,未来的优秀应用将不仅是工具,更是智能体。
实施路径:敏捷开发与自动化测试双轮驱动
面对快速迭代的市场需求,传统的瀑布式开发模式已难以适应。推荐采用敏捷开发流程,结合GitLab CI/CD实现持续集成与部署,配合XCTest与SwiftLint进行自动化测试与代码规范检查。通过设置每日构建任务,可在第一时间发现兼容性问题或崩溃异常。对于性能瓶颈,可借助Instruments工具分析内存泄漏、CPU占用及渲染帧率,及时优化资源加载策略。此外,利用TestFlight进行灰度发布,收集真实用户反馈,也是提升产品质量的有效手段。这些方法虽看似基础,却是保障苹果软件开发项目稳定落地的关键支撑。
常见问题与解决建议:应对审核延迟与性能挑战
许多开发者在提交App Store审核时遭遇过延迟甚至被拒的情况,主要原因是未遵循最新指南要求。例如,隐私标签(Privacy Nutrition Label)填写不完整、后台定位权限滥用、内购流程不清晰等问题均可能导致驳回。为此,建议在开发初期即建立合规审查清单,并定期更新以匹配苹果官方政策变化。至于性能优化,应避免在主线程执行耗时操作,优先使用DispatchQueue分发任务;对于图片资源,应采用WebP格式并配合ImageCache缓存机制;对于网络请求,则可通过URLSession配置合理的超时时间与重试策略。这些细节虽小,却直接影响用户留存率与评分。
若企业能系统掌握苹果软件开发的核心能力,将有望实现用户留存率提升30%、应用内购买转化率增长25%等可量化的成果。更重要的是,这将推动整个移动应用生态向更安全、智能、一体化的方向演进,真正实现技术赋能商业的价值闭环。
我们专注于为企业提供专业的苹果软件开发服务,涵盖从需求分析、原型设计到上线维护的全生命周期支持,擅长运用Swift语言与现代化开发工具链打造高性能、高安全性的应用产品,帮助客户在竞争激烈的市场中建立可持续的优势,如有相关需求欢迎联系18140119082
